快速幂

int pow(int a ,int k)
{
    int rec = 1;
    while( k )
    {
        if (k & 1)
            rec *= a;
        a *= a;
        k >>= 1;
    }
    return rec;
}
posted @ 2013-09-09 19:13  我家小破孩儿  阅读(106)  评论(0编辑  收藏  举报